Concrete can be purchased by the cubic yard. How much will it cost to pour a circular slab 18 ft in diameter by 3 in. for a pati

o if the concrete costs $40.00 per cubic yard?
(1 cubic yard = 27 cubic feet)

How to solve -7(x-1)^2-2 vertex form to standard form
ahrayia [7]
Expand it

-7(x-1)^2-2
-7(x^2-2x+1)-2
-7x^2+14x-7-2
-7x^2+14x-9 is standard form
